Ingredients of "Irish" stew (vegan)

  1. Prepare 3 of medium potatoes.
  2. It's 4 of medium carrots.
  3. It's 1 of large onion.
  4. You need 1 can of lentils.
  5. Prepare 250 ml of veg stock.
  6. Prepare 3 tbsp of tomato puree.
  7. It's 2 of garlic cloves (or 1 tsp minced garlic).
  8. Prepare 2 tsp of ground cumin.
  9. You need 2 tsp of ground coriander.
  10. It's 500 ml of stout.
  11. You need of salt and pepper to taste.

"Irish" stew (vegan) inst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 180C..
  2. Chop the veg into chunks (about 2cm cubed)..
  3. Make up the stock and add the garlic (chopped), tomato puree and spices.
  4. Add the vegetables, lentils, stock mixture and stout to a large casserole dish with a lid. (If you don't have a lidded pot, add an extra 250ml of water.).
  5. Cook in the oven for about 2 hours..
